Dubrovnik Transportation: DBV airport to downtown Dubrovnik
Posted: Wed April 29, 2009 06:03 PM UTC
How much (Euros) it would be to
1) Take a taxi from DBV airport to Dubrovnik downtown?
2) Take airport shuttle from DBV to downtown?

Do taxi drivers use meters in Croatia (including Zagreb)? Do we need to pay them tip?

Dubrovnik Re: Transportation: DBV airport to downtown Dubrovnik
Posted: Wed June 3, 2009 12:27 PM UTC
Current prices (season 2009) from Dubrovnik Airport (Cilipi) to Dubrovnik.

Taxi: ca. 30 Euro

Note: Tipping the taxi driver is not obligatory, but if you were satisfied with the service it's always appreciated with a small tip. There is a taxi station right in front of the arrivals terminal, you can also reserve a taxi online.

Shuttle bus: ca. 5 Euro/per person (buses run on a fixed schedule, usually synced with plain arrival times)
